You can't block this pop-up in Safari but if you have iCab you can set a filter to block it very effectively. You'll see the URL I gave above - just type that in as a user-defined filter in iCab and you'll not see that pop-up again.

The only browsers I've tried are Safari (of course), iSwifter, Opera and iCab.

I chose iCab (it's only £1.49) because several Members had recommended it. It's certainly a lot better than iSwifter and Opera, in my opinion. It's infinitely configurable and the Developer seems to be committed to the app.

There are a few minor 'niggles' with it...

but it has a Safari-like GUI, so you're not confronted with something entirely alien. You can download and *upload* files, there's no stupid 20MB limit on 3G etc.
